Transaction 171a7da6a752c2e33069431539f6415ff39daf079649b93c9ab9cdafdfb5857f

1 Input
2 Outputs
  • 171a7da6a752c2e33069431539f6415ff39daf079649b93c9ab9cdafdfb5857f:0
  • value  3840496
    address  3K92JwF4ccfo3A3CLKuhdLcoz99vx44j1Z
  • 171a7da6a752c2e33069431539f6415ff39daf079649b93c9ab9cdafdfb5857f:1
  • value  144338
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w